Wine Consumption, Mediterranean Diet, and Cardiovascular Risk in Two Spanish Cohorts

MedXY Editorial Team•Jul 14, 2026•Cardiology
cardiovascular riskMediterranean dietMortalityPREDIMEDSUN projectwine consumption

Introduction

The Mediterranean diet (MedDiet), rich in fruits, vegetables, whole grains, nuts, and healthy fats, is well established as beneficial for cardiovascular health. A debated component of this diet is wine consumption, which some studies suggest may confer health benefits, especially when consumed moderately, while others highlight potential risks. The aim of this study was to evaluate the association between adherence to the MedDiet—with and without wine consumption—and the risks of major cardiovascular disease (CVD) events and all-cause mortality in two large Spanish cohorts: the older, high-risk PREDIMED study and the younger, general-population SUN project.
